Emerson Network Power Adds Advanced Controls and Variable Capacity to Liebert Challenger 3000 Precision Cooling System

10/19/2009

Columbus, Ohio [October 15, 2009] – Data center managers seeking increased control and operating efficiency of their precision cooling systems may now deploy the Liebert Challenger 3000 with Liebert iCOM controls from Emerson Network Power, a business of Emerson (NYSE: EMR) and the global leader in enabling Business-Critical Continuity™. The enhanced Liebert Challenger 3000 also has the ability to integrate an energy-efficient digital scroll compressor if chosen as an option.

The Liebert Challenger 3000 precision cooling system provides complete environmental control, including cooling, reheat, dehumidification, humidification and filtration. Its compact footprint makes it ideal for facilities where space is a premium. All of the system’s critical components are front-accessible, so the unit can be corner-installed or installed flush against other equipment. The unit also utilizes environmentally-friendly refrigerant R-407C, making it compliant with the Montreal Protocol and the U.S. EPA Clean Air Act.

The addition of the Liebert iCOM control system enables up to 32 units to communicate and work together as a team to precisely control temperature and humidity across a room while optimizing the efficiency of the entire cooling system. The control system also enhances the reliability of the cooling system by allowing predictive, performance-based analysis. It displays real-time information, such as setpoints, environmental conditions, operational status and alarm conditions. In addition, two Liebert IntelliSlot card housings enable simple network management protocol (SNMP) or Web-based centralized monitoring, or monitoring via an existing building management system or Liebert SiteScan Web.

The digital scroll compressor, which is available in a self-contained system design, allows unit capacities to quickly adapt to changing room conditions. The technology is capable of responding to changes as small as +/- 1 degree Fahrenheit (Celsius) and +/- 1 percent RH (relative humidity).

“As a result of these enhancements, the Liebert Challenger 3000 can be more precisely matched to the exact requirements of a data center,” said Bob Blough, director of marketing, Liebert Precision Cooling, Emerson Network Power. “This approach has shown to be as much as 30 percent more efficient than traditional hot-gas bypass when the system needs to operate at a reduced capacity.”

The system is available in self-contained or split system designs, which enable the unit to be fitted with a variety of architectures. Cooling configurations include air, water, glycol, GLYCOOL and chilled water. It is available in nominal ratings of 10.5 kW (3 tons) and 17.5 kW (5 tons) and in upflow and downflow configurations.

Emerson Network Power Bolsters Desktop, Point-of-Sale Power Protection with Liebert PSP Backup Power Unit

8/4/2009

Columbus, Ohio [July 28, 2009] – As professional workstations, point-of-sale terminals and other small but critical office equipment are increasingly susceptible to utility power fluctuations and poor overall power quality, individuals and small businesses are looking for new levels of power protection to maintain system continuity and network connections. Emerson Network Power’s new Liebert PSP uninterruptible power supply (UPS) provides an affordable answer to this challenge by ensuring ample battery time for a short ride-through or an orderly shutdown for extended power outages.

Four models of the next-generation Liebert PSP are available in capacities of 350VA/120V, 500VA/120V, 500VA/230V and 650VA/230V, and are backed by an industry-leading, two-year replacement warranty. Amid the often frantic period when utility power is lost, the Liebert PSP delivers up to five minutes of backup power at full load. Users also benefit from advanced early warnings when the UPS is beginning to shut down, via the Liebert MultiLink software that accompanies each Liebert PSP. Additional product features include:
Power protection via three battery-backed outlets
Surge protection via one surge outlet that is color-coded for easy identification
User-replaceable batteries are convenient for on-site maintenance
Compliance with the European Union’s Restriction of Hazardous Substances Directive (RoHS) prohibiting the use of six hazardous materials in the manufacturing of electronics, which makes the compliant product more environmentally friendly at the end of its life
Two-year replacement warranty includes battery health and covers shipment to and from the user site

The Liebert PSP is available immediately throughout the world and comes with a Quick-Start Guide of step-by-step instructions for quick and easy deployment.

Emerson Network Power Introduces SmartAisle™ Solution to Improve Effectiveness of Data Center Cooling

Columbus, Ohio [March 9, 2010] – As high heat densities continue to push the limits of data center cooling, Emerson Network Power, a business of Emerson (NYSE: EMR) and the global leader in enabling Business-Critical Continuity™, today introduced the SmartAisle cooling management solution that utilizes cold aisle containment to increase cooling efficiency and rack capacity. The SmartAisle solution is available to customers worldwide.

Leveraging the hot aisle/cold aisle rack configuration, the flexible SmartAisle solution contains the cold aisle to prevent hot and cold air from mixing, while adding a layer of intelligent management through the Liebert iCOM™ control system. The combination of cold aisle containment and precise aisle-level control of temperature, humidity and airflow allows the SmartAisle solution to deliver greater than 30 percent energy savings and a 25 percent cooling capacity increase without compromising availability.

“Containment has proven to be an effective approach to increasing cooling system efficiency, but containment without control is only a partial solution,” said Fred Stack, vice president of marketing for the Liebert Precision Cooling business of Emerson Network Power in North America. “With the SmartAisle solution we’ve taken containment to the next level, magnifying the results that can be achieved by providing greater control of the contained environment while also enabling a modular approach to data center optimization.”

Knurr® cabinets from Emerson Network Power are utilized within the cold-aisle containment structure. The SmartAisle solution can also be adapted to existing IT racks. A clear plexiglass ceiling system serves as a roof to contain cold air. Swinging or sliding doors contain the areas at the ends of the aisle. Horizontal and vertical rack blanking panels are used to optimize the cabinet airflow. An alternative curtain system is available for ceiling containment as an alternative to the plexiglass ceiling panels.

The addition of the Liebert iCOM control system provides monitoring, control and communications vital to the SmartAisle solution’s significant performance improvement over standard containment structures. Remote sensors in both the hot and cold aisles allow Liebert iCOM to ensure proper temperature, humidity and airflow to the inlet of the servers. The control system monitors conditions in the cold aisle to independently control both the variable capacity compressor (or chilled-water cooling capacity) and the fan speed of the cooling units and allows the units to work in teamwork mode for energy-efficient load sharing operation.

“While constructing our newest energy efficient, high-density co-location facility in Santa Clara, we evaluated several different energy saving infrastructures for our 30,000-square-foot data center to support over 1,000 high-density cabinets. Our goal was to find a solution that would provide us with efficient cooling, while we gradually expand our customer base,” said Tom Wye, president and CEO, Bay Area Internet Solutions. “Carefully comparing the various technologies, we found that the SmartAisle solution from Emerson Network Power would provide us with the most efficient and flexible cooling system available. The SmartAisle solution is now an integral component of our cooling infrastructure.”

"Nemertes sees sensor-driven intelligent management of cooling as the most important improvement in data center climate control in many years,” said John Burke, a principal research analyst at Nemertes Research. “Fifty-nine percent of the enterprises Nemertes speaks with say that data center HVAC is still a challenge, especially problems with density, efficiency, and control of airflow.  Improved, and especially more intelligent, cooling infrastructure is their main strategy for addressing such problems."

The SmartAisle solution can be used on raised or non-raised floors, and is compatible with variable capacity Liebert DS and Liebert CW cooling units containing Liebert iCOM controls, as well as row-based Liebert CRV and Liebert XD systems with Liebert iCOM controls. The system is capable of cooling up to 30kW per rack, depending on whether internal or external cooling is used with the cold aisle containment. Existing IT racks can be retrofitted with a SmartAisle containment system.
